Like Jenny, I am a card maker not a scrapbook maker so I could never figure how to use the 12x12 papers. Two suggestions I found on other sites. First is to cut them up as , Jenny does but turn them over so you be do not see the designs. For some reason, the cuts always make for beautiful designs. The second is to cut them in irregular but fairly large pieces and wrap this pieces with ribbon. Use Jenny's pocket design insert the pieces into a pocket and give them as puzzle cards. This works really well with the full sheet sentiment papers.
